@ts-ast-parser/core
Version:
Reflects a simplified version of the TypeScript AST for generating documentation
12 lines • 398 B
JavaScript
import { EnumNode } from '../nodes/enum-node.js';
import ts from 'typescript';
export const enumFactory = {
isNode: (node) => {
return ts.isEnumDeclaration(node);
},
create: (node, context) => {
const reflectedNode = context.registerReflectedNode(node, () => new EnumNode(node, context));
return [reflectedNode];
},
};
//# sourceMappingURL=create-enum.js.map